Hi,
I'm new to Reason and Im using Reason 5.
I have a quick question, when I setup Matrix's with sequencers that I want to use and I have several tracks on the board everytime I press play to listen to the patterns I've copied to tracks/board all the matrixs will run too! So basically I have the copied matrixs patterns playing but also the matrixs themselves will 'run' so I find when I press play to listen to my track I have to then turn off all the matrixs that are running. Could anyone help here because it's such a pain having to turn them all off every time I just want to listen to what I've done.
Much appreciated!
Reason query
Well you have at least 3 choices,
if you send the pattern to track your not using the matrix any more so either disconnect it or turn it off.
you can also use pattern automation if you design multiple patterns across the bank.
or just leave it to play when you hit either of the run buttons, the one on the matrix or the master transport.
But it's not as smart as the new player, they will actually switch off once you send to track, but that's just as annoying sometimes, so it really is on you to make the decision.
Hope that helps.
